Main duties of the job

1. Undertake new patient health checks

2. Support the practice nurse with health promotion programmes

3. Carry out baseline observations such as pulse oximetry, blood pressure, temperature, pulse rate, recording findings accurately

4. Facilitate routine and 24-hour BP monitoring, advising patients accordingly

5. Undertake wound care, dressings and other clinical tasks as required

6. Support the practice nurse with the management of chronic disease clinics

7. Carry out BMI checks as directed

8. Act as a chaperone as required

9. When trained, undertake venipuncture

10. When trained, administer flu vaccinations

11. When trained, carry out ear irrigation under the supervision of the practice nurse

12. Carry out ECGs as requested

13. Ensure specimens are recorded and ready for onward transportation

14. Provide support during minor operations as required

15. Ensure all clinical rooms are adequately stocked and prepared for each session

16. Ensure fridges are cleaned routinely in accordance with extant guidance

17. Ensure clinical waste is removed from clinical areas and sharps bins replaced in accordance with the practice IPC policy

18. Deliver opportunistic health promotion where appropriate

19. Participate in practice audit as directed

20. Participate in local initiatives to enhance service delivery and patient care

21. Support and participate in shared learning within the practice
